Boxwood pruning services involve the careful trimming and shaping of boxwood shrubs to maintain their aesthetic appeal and health. This process typically includes removing dead or damaged branches, thinning out overgrown areas, and shaping the foliage to achieve a desired form. Proper pruning encourages dense growth, enhances the natural shape of the shrub, and can help prevent issues related to overgrowth. Professionals utilize specialized tools and techniques to ensure that the pruning is precise and promotes the long-term vitality of the plants.

Pruning services for boxwoods can address several common problems, such as disease, pest infestations, and overgrown or unruly growth. Over time, boxwoods may develop issues like leaf browning, thinning, or dieback, which can be mitigated through targeted trimming. Regular pruning also helps improve air circulation within the shrub, reducing the likelihood of fungal infections. Additionally, it can prevent the shrub from becoming too dense, which can hinder sunlight penetration and overall plant health.

Basic Pruning - The typical cost for basic boxwood pruning ranges from $50 to $150 per shrub, depending on size and complexity. Smaller bushes generally cost less, while larger or more intricate shapes may incur higher fees.

Hedge Trimming - For boxwood hedges, prices usually fall between $200 and $600 for a standard-sized hedge. The total cost depends on length, height, and the density of the foliage.

Deep Shaping and Topiary - More detailed shaping services can range from $300 to over $1,000, especially for elaborate designs or extensive trimming. Costs vary based on the complexity and size of the desired shape.

Maintenance Packages - Ongoing maintenance services typically cost between $100 and $300 per visit, with frequency influencing the total expense. These packages often include regular pruning to maintain the desired appearance.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

Why is pruning boxwood shrubs important? Pruning helps maintain the health, shape, and appearance of boxwood plants by removing dead or overgrown branches.

When is the best time to prune boxwood? The ideal time to prune boxwood is during late winter or early spring before new growth begins.

Can I prune boxwood myself or should I hire a professional? While light pruning can be done by homeowners, hiring a professional ensures proper techniques and healthy growth management.

What tools are typically used for boxwood pruning? Common tools include sharp pruning shears, loppers, and hedge trimmers designed for precise cuts.

How often should boxwood shrubs be pruned? Regular pruning is usually recommended once or twice a year to maintain desired shape and promote healthy growth.
